The U.S. Treasury Department has accused Banque Misr's branches in the United Arab Emirates of assisting Iran, which is under sanctions. In response, the Emirati central bank has pledged to conduct an examination into the matter. This development comes amid ongoing tensions between the U.S. and Iran over financial activities linked to sanctioned entities.
